
Shaq's Big Challenge
Where to Watch Shaq's Big Challenge

Shaq's Big Challenge is a captivating reality television show that aired on the ABC network in 2007. This invigorating program is fronted by the dynamic and highly personable former NBA superstar, Shaquille O'Neal, renowned for his talent both on and off the court. This show is designed to deliver an inspiring message about the significance of physical health and well-being, specifically among young children. It encourages its audience to adopt more active lifestyles and healthier dietary habits.
Guided by the belief that today’s sedentary lifestyle is threatening the health and future of America's children, O’Neal decided to kick off an audacious campaign to reverse this trend. In doing so, he becomes a beacon of motivation and guidance for six overweight children. The underlying premise of Shaq's Big Challenge extends beyond just losing weight, aiming instead to revolutionize the children's entire lifestyle, by overhauling their exercise and eating habits for more sustainable and healthier options.

To ensure a holistic approach, the show has enlisted the help of professional medical and fitness consultants. Doctors, therapists, nutritionists, personal trainers, a chef, and even a child psychologist all join forces to lend their expertise to this transformative journey. They work diligently to provide the crucial support and guidance that the children need, further ensuring their fitness and health goals' success.

Shaq's Big Challenge is a series categorized as a canceled. Spanning 1 seasons with a total of 6 episodes, the show debuted on 2007. The series has earned a moderate reviews from both critics and viewers. The IMDb score stands at 7.4.
